Review of Rheumatoid Arthritis Medications
When taking care of rheumatoid joint inflammation, comprehending the drugs readily available is essential for efficient therapy. You'll experience numerous classifications of drugs made to soothe symptoms and slow illness progression.
N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s) help reduce pain and swelling, while corticosteroids can give fast relief throughout flare-ups.
Disease-modifying antirheumatic drugs (DMARDs) are crucial for long-term administration, as they target the underlying illness procedure, preventing joint damages. Methotrexate is just one of the most generally recommended DMARDs.
In addition, you may discover over the counter choices for moderate pain alleviation.
Working closely with your doctor guarantees you locate the most effective medicine plan customized to your needs, stabilizing performance with possible negative effects. Staying educated empowers you to make the best choices for your health.
Comprehending Biologics and Their Role in Therapy
Biologics play a crucial role in dealing with rheumatoid joint inflammation, especially when traditional DMARDs aren't effective enough.
These medicines target specific pathways in your immune system, aiding to reduce swelling and avoid joint damage. Unlike standard therapies, biologics are derived from living microorganisms and are customized to address the underlying sources of your condition.
You'll normally get them via injection or mixture, and they may take several weeks to show results.
Usual biologics consist of TNF inhibitors and IL-6 receptor antagonists.
It's important to function closely with your healthcare provider to check your action and change dosages as needed.
While they can be extremely efficient, know prospective side effects and the need for normal examinations throughout therapy.
Emerging Therapies for Handling Rheumatoid Arthritis
As research study in rheumatoid arthritis remains to breakthrough, brand-new therapies are arising that increase treatment options past typical medicines and biologics.
One exciting area is Janus kinase (JAK) preventions, which target details pathways associated with inflammation. These dental medicines can provide quick alleviation and enhanced feature for many people.
Furthermore, scientists are discovering the capacity of stem cell treatment, which aims to regrow damaged tissues and modulate the immune reaction.
